Jets QB says Tebow is 'here to help us.' Terry McCormick
Mark Sanchez doesn't sound like a man who could be headed for a quarterback controversy with Tim Tebow.
Sanchez broke his silence on Monday, telling Newsday's Rod Boone that Tebow was brought on board to help the Jets and that he isn't worried about losing his starting role.
"We are adding another player and we are not replacing anybody. He’s here to help us and I’m confident in my abilities," Sanchez said.
Sanchez added that he believes Tebow, acquired from Denver on Friday, will be welcomed into the Jets locker room, and that he would be part of that welcoming process.
Sanchez also didn't take issue with management, he says, about not being consulted prior to the Jets' pursuit of Tebow, and added, "I have faith in those guys upstairs."
